Description
The product comes with part numbers 778686-01, 778032-01, 783007-01, indicating its various models or configurations. It supports an information exchange rate of more than 1.5 MB/s as per IEEE 488.1 standards, and it can achieve speeds up to more than 7.7 MB/s using HS488, ensuring rapid data communication.
With a sampling rate of 20 MHz, it can accurately capture data at high frequencies, making it suitable for demanding applications. The device also features a timestamp resolution of 50 ns, which allows for precise timing measurements.
It is designed to fulfill multiple roles such as Talker, Listener, and Controller, providing flexibility in how it can be integrated into various systems. The IEEE 488 connector is a 24-pin I/O connector, ensuring a reliable connection for data transfer.
The maximum cable length between devices can extend up to 4 meters, allowing for considerable distance in setups, while the average cable length is typically 2 meters or less, optimizing for most common configurations.
Regarding its physical dimensions, the device measures either 5.3 x 4.2 inches or 4.72 x 2.54 inches, depending on the serial number, providing compact and versatile options for installation. It operates within a temperature range of 0 °C to 55 °C and has a storage temperature range of -20 °C to 70 °C, ensuring durability and reliability in various environmental conditions.
